Centered within the abdominal cavity, the small intestine occupies most of the umbilical and hypogastric regions as tightly packed loops shown through a translucent anterior abdominal wall. Proximally, the duodenum begins just inferior to the stomach and sweeps toward the patient’s right before turning left at the duodenojejunal flexure, where the jejunum continues as thicker-caliber, more proximal coils. Distally, the ileum forms finer loops that trend inferiorly and toward the right lower quadrant, approaching the ileocecal junction. Mesenteric support is implied by the fan-like distribution of the loops from a relatively fixed root. This anterior orientation is the one clinicians mentally map during abdominal examination and cross-sectional imaging, because the small bowel shifts freely within the peritoneal cavity while key transition points remain comparatively constant. The duodenojejunal junction anchors at the ligament of Treitz, a landmark used to localize upper gastrointestinal bleeding, malrotation, and to separate foregut from midgut derivatives in teaching. Bowel obstruction often declares itself by proximal dilation and distal decompression, and this type of global, proportional rendering helps learners understand why jejunal loops tend to sit more left and central while the ileum commonly occupies the lower abdomen and pelvis.
